The key to success in this area is hard work and creativity! Many traditional recipes can be reproduced into a gluten free copies! Yes, they may have a slightly different texture, but it can be done. :) Fortunately, for those who are just avoiding gluten there are many premixed flour that work beautifully as substitutes.
For those of us with food allergies as well as gluten sensitivity, substituting is a little more complicated. Mixing your own flours becomes a necessity. Potato starch, tapioca starch, and freshly milled brown rice flour is my go to for legume free, corn free, nut free, gluten free, and gum free flour.
